A Victorian silver-gilt mounted double-ended glass scent-bottle
Maker's mark of E. H. Stockwell, London, 1884
The oval glass body with central section mounted with silver-gilt rockwork, lilies and lily-pads enclosing four fish, the silver-gilt neck mounts and hinged domed covers with push-piece, the ends with intaglio cypher and two crests and motto, marked on mounts
5¼in. (13.2cm.) long
